Chilean Aguas Andinas placed a sustainable bond in the Swiss market
05/16/2024 Since 1 year
Aguas Andinas, a Chilean environmental services company, issued an inaugural bond in the Swiss market for the equivalent of 110 million dollars. The company, rated A- by Standard & Poors, obtained a coupon of 2.0975% in the Swiss currency.
The objective is to strengthen the company’s balance sheet to address the deployment of new works and projects that will provide Santiago with greater adaptation and water resilience in the face of climate change.
